How To Write Resume For Drywall Stripper

  • Highlight your experience and skills in drywall removal, including specific projects or accomplishments that demonstrate your expertise.
  • Showcase your knowledge of different stripping methods and your ability to adapt to various job requirements.
  • Emphasize your commitment to safety and your understanding of industry regulations and best practices.
  • Provide examples of your ability to work independently and as part of a team, meeting deadlines and exceeding expectations.

Essential Experience Highlights for a Strong Drywall Stripper Resume

Elevate your Drywall Stripper resume by showcasing these essential responsibilities and achievements in your experience section. These examples will help you stand out from the competition.
  • Safely and effectively remove drywall from interior and exterior surfaces using various stripping methods, including hand stripping, power stripping, and chemical stripping.
  • Meticulously remove drywall down to studs, leaving surfaces clean and prepared for further work.
  • Prepare work areas by covering surfaces and protecting fixtures from debris and damage.
  • Operate power tools and equipment, such as reciprocating saws, demolition hammers, and dust extractors, safely and efficiently.
  • Maintain a clean and organized work environment, adhering to safety and health regulations.
  • Handle and dispose of hazardous materials, such as asbestos and lead, safely and responsibly.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’s) For Drywall Stripper

  • What are the different methods of drywall removal?

    Drywall removal methods include hand stripping, power stripping, and chemical stripping.

  • What tools and equipment are used for drywall removal?

    Drywall removal typically requires the use of reciprocating saws, demolition hammers, dust extractors, and protective gear.

  • How do you safely remove drywall?

    Drywall removal should be done safely by wearing protective gear, covering surfaces, and handling hazardous materials appropriately.

  • What are the key skills required for a Drywall Stripper?

    Key skills for a Drywall Stripper include proficiency in drywall removal techniques, knowledge of power tools, attention to detail, and adherence to safety regulations.
